It is crucial to purchase a mobility scooter that has been thoroughly examined when you plan to buy a second-hand model. This will ensure that the product is in good condition and will perform as expected. It's also cheaper than buying a brand new scooter, which can be costly for many people. Purchasing a used scooter from a reputable seller is the best way to go since they will be able provide expert advice and tips on how to maintain and operate the scooter.
When looking for a secondhand scooter, you need to think about your needs and the type of terrain you will be using it on. You should look for an electric scooter that is light and has high-performance tires. This will let you travel farther distances and also avoid problems with traction. Check the maximum capacity of the scooter's weight.
Be cautious when purchasing a used scooter as the seller may not be honest about the condition. You should also inquire for a warranty from the seller to be sure you're protected in the event that something goes wrong with it. You should also inquire about how often the scooter has been used and where it is stored when it is not in use.

It's a good idea to purchase from a reputable dealer rather than an individual seller, when purchasing a second-hand scooter. A licensed supplier will provide you with complete warranty and has likely examined the scooter to be sure it's operating in good condition. If you decide to purchase from a private person you should ask them why they are selling the scooter and how long they have owned it.
If a scooter has been recently repaired, it will likely have several beeps you can hear if there's a problem. These beeps are a manufacturer-programmed code that can be deciphered by a scooter technician.
When you're choosing a scooter you must also take into consideration the speed. While some users only need a basic scooter for travelling around town, others need more speed. Recreational scooters tend to be faster, but they offer an unsteady ride. However, they can be fun. It is important to keep in mind that these types of scooters were not made for medical use, so it's best to use them on flat, safe routes. Otherwise, they can be risky. A scooter with three to four wheels is more sturdy than a two-wheeled model because it grips the ground better.

A second-hand mobility vehicle can be a viable option for those who can't afford a new one. It is crucial to do some research so that you are getting a fair price. A reputable mobility shop will offer a scooter that has been thoroughly tested, and might even offer an assurance. You should also consider the type of scooter you need. If you need to travel for long distances, it is recommended that you look at a heavy-duty model rather than the smaller lightweight model.
Before you purchase a new scooter it is essential to think about the costs of maintenance. A scooter that is maintained will last longer than one that is not. It is advisable to avoid buying an old scooter that has many repairs. It is also important to ensure that the battery and axles are in good shape. Ask the seller how often he or they used the scooter in order to determine its condition.
An effective method to determine the condition of a used mobility scooter is to steer it with care and listen for any bumps. If you hear a thump and thump sound, it's likely that the tires are flat. You can ask the seller to leave the battery plugged in for a few hours. The indicator light for the battery will indicate a fully charged battery.
